To try and keep it short.... I have a RS 15-2116 remote...I have customized it to about 80% of where I want to be.

been a while and am reading up again. But the BIG thing is I lost my customized Device codes ( the txt files from KM) I was a good boy and saved them after customizing...but....my computer bit the dust and have LOST all that data.

I have made a backup of the current config....in IR.exe.......

Is there a way to get that IR.exe "backup" info back into KM to save my current settings (as txt Files) for EACH device Code and work with them further...or do I have to start from scratch!!!!!

I am just not educated enough to write the codes in IR itself...A beginner like me REALLY likes the KM files......

I want to ADD to what I already have....but w/o the currently config. txt files Im afraid of "Leaping" backwards!!!

there is only one thing you can do. Any device upgrades will show up under the devices tab. It'll list the buttons and their efcs. Use these to rebuild the upgrade. If there are any as keymoves, they'll show on the keymove tab, just look for the upgrade setup code #.

IR will give you all the EFCs that are assigned to each button, but it won't tell you what the function really is, so you'll have to get that from your memory (ie, what does the PIP button do is DVD mode, etc)

IR won't tell you the protocol or device code info, but most of the experts here would be easily able to tell you that just from looking at your IR.exe file, so you should post it in the Diagnosis Area.

Of course, if you had loaded up your KM files for others to share (in the Yahoo Device Codes folder) you'd be able to download them yourself! :)

Just out of curiosity, have you checked the file section to see if someone else has saved KM files for your devices.
